Historic Downtown Baton Rouge
Historic Downtown Baton Rouge is a destination visitors seek out for is ample dining options, casino gaming, and beautiful river views. You might also want to check out attractions like Shaw Center for the Arts or The Old Governor's Mansion while you're exploring the neighborhood.
